Dynamically driven.
Designed to be driven by any high quality Pre Amplifier, and designed to achieve the full untapped potential from your dynamic headphones, the Reference Dynamic Headphone Amp is a fully balanced amplifier.
Boasting 139dB of dynamic range, the amp works in tandem with the Reference and Select DAC, allowing the music to come to life in vibrant and unforgettable new ways.
CNC billet chassis.
Starting with a 65lb plate of raw aluminium, material is machined in MSB’s own in-house CNC shop.
After more than four hours of machining, 60% of the aluminium is removed, resulting in a significantly lighter, more contoured product with the best anodized finishes on the market.
4-Pin XLR
Each amplifier is equipped with three 4-pin XLR outputs, designed for a shared listening experience.
Fully equipped.
A rear-facing headphone jack allows for a cleaner system aesthetic there aren’t any dangling cables interfering with a cleanly assembled system.
The noise floor is reduced with an isolated transformer and grounding scheme. 12 Volt triggers allow remote control over the system power.
Analogue bypass.
If you’re sharing the headphones with a two-channel system, use MSB’s internal bypass we’ve installed directly into the amp. Simply turn off the unit for the signal to be sent to your other system.
Technical Specifications:
The Dynamic Headphone Amplifier |
|
|---|---|
| Supported Formats | Analogue Only |
| XLR Analog Inputs | Optimized for 75 or 150 Balanced Source |
| XLR Analog Outputs | Direct connection to input when enabled or unit powered off. When listening to headphones, output is muted with 75 output impedance |
| Headphone Output Impedance | 0.45 |
| Dynamic Range 20Hz-20kHz (Max Power at 45) |
>139dB >141dBA |
| Frequency Response | 5Hz-20kHz ±0.016dB |
| Common Mode Rejection Ratio | > 95dB CMRR @ 60Hz > 95dB CMRR @ 1kHz > 80dB CMRR @ 20kHz |
| Crosstalk | <-130dB Crosstalk @ 1kHz <-110dB Crosstalk @ 20kHz |
| SMPTE IMD 0dBu | 0.0019% @ 45 |
| % THD+N 1kHz 0dBu | 0.00065% @ 45 |
| Max Power @ 1% THD+N | 16 @ 4.25Vrms (1.12W) |
| 32 @ 8.6Vrms (2.3W) | |
| 45 @ 15.5Vrms (5.3W) | |
| 150 @ 15.6Vrms (1.62W) | |
| Noise Floor (150 Input Impedance) |
0.00168mVrms 20Hz-20kHz |
| Headphone Output Connectors | 1x Rear 4 Pin XLR 2x Front 4 Pin XLR |
| Display | Power LED |
| Controls | IR Remote (Configurable) Power Button (Configurable) 2x MSB 12V Trigger |
| Power Consumption |
64 Watts 230v or 120v compatible – Supplied with external PSU for 120v use. also |
| Topology | |
| Input/Gain Stage | – Class-A – Double balanced – Impedance matched – DC coupled – Fully discrete |
| Output Stage | – Class-A – Balanced – Current gain only |
| Chassis Dimensions | |
| Width: | 17.5 in (444 mm) |
| Depth: | 17.5 in (444 mm) |
| Chassis Height (Without Feet): | 2.2 in (56 mm) |
| Stack height: | 2.85 in (92 mm) |
| Weight: | 34 lbs (15.5 kg) |
| Product Feet: | M6X1 Thread |
| Shipping Dimensions | |
| Width: | 23 in (585 mm) |
| Depth: | 23 in (585 mm) |
| Height: | 7 in (178 mm) |
| Weight: | 42 lbs (19 kg) |
